SUICIDE AWARENESS AND PREVENTION

“I Want to Kill Myself” and “How to Kill Myself” were searched online over 30,000 times in Canada last year.

 
 
 

Research shows that Public Safety Personnel (PSP, eg. correctional workers, dispatchers, firefighters, paramedics, police) experience higher levels of suicidal behaviour than the general public. The demanding nature of their work, exposure to traumatic events, and long hours under intense pressure can lead to increased vulnerability to mental health struggles
